Tap water in Tirana
Not safe to drink
Based on resident-reported scores for Tirana, in Albania.
What the sources say
26/100 on the water drinkability and accessibility index, which Numbeo reads as “Low”. Crowdsourced from residents rather than measured.
Nationally, 87% of people in Albania have safely managed drinking water.
No measured quality report for Tirana yet. If you know a reliable local source, leave it in the comments and we will add it.
Even where the water is safe, ask locally. Older buildings can carry lead or copper pipework, and one street can differ from the network feeding it.
